Essential Job Duties:
This position provides comprehensive patient care and care coordination for the Nephrology and Urology service within the Randall B. Terry Jr. Companion Animal Medical Center. The service delivers specialty-level care for patients requiring advanced evaluation and treatment of urinary and renal conditions in a fast-paced, teaching-hospital environment. This role requires in-depth veterinary medical knowledge, strong organizational and communication skills, and the ability to collaborate effectively with clinicians, staff, students, clients, and referring veterinarians.

Key Responsibilities:

Specialty Patient Care & Treatment Support

Provide comprehensive direct patient care across specialty services, including support for diagnostic, therapeutic, and procedural treatments. Responsibilities include patient monitoring, medication and therapy administration, post-sedation and post-procedure recovery, pain management, and ongoing patient assessment to ensure safety and comfort throughout the continuum of care.

Procedural, Diagnostic & Technical Support

Prepare and assist with diagnostic and therapeutic procedures using aseptic technique; maintain sterile environments; support sedation and anesthesia-related activities; and operate specialized equipment while coordinating diagnostic imaging and testing such as CT, MRI, ultrasound, and radiography.

Client, rDVM & Interdisciplinary Communication

Participate in client check-in, patient admitting, scheduling, and updates, and work directly with referring veterinarians, clinicians, and hospital teams to facilitate clear communication and coordinated care that supports optimal patient outcomes and client satisfaction.

Workflow, Documentation & Financial Coordination

Coordinate patient visits and services, including diagnostic, surgical, anesthetic, medication, and sample requests; accurately document patient care and communications in hospital information systems; and participate in billing, estimates, and charge entry.

Education, Compliance & Operational Support

Orient and train staff and learners; maintain equipment readiness and appropriate supply levels; uphold a clean and safe work environment; and ensure compliance with hospital policies, infectious disease protocols, OSHA, EHS, and radiation safety training requirements.

Documentation, Safety & Compliance
Accurately document patient care and treatments within hospital information systems while maintaining a clean, safe work environment and adhering to infectious disease protocols, OSHA, EHS, and radiation safety standards. Ability to lift up to 50 pounds, with or without reasonable accommodations.
